Up Late Video Sketch Writing Class
Have you ever wanted to write for a comedy show or produce a sketch video? This 8-week course taught by the writers and producers of STL Up Late will teach students how to pitch an idea, write sketch comedy scripts, rewrite as part of a team, and direct the sketch for video.

Students will be put in an environment that mimics writing for a show like Saturday Night Live in which the writing starts as an individual process and ends as a collaborative one.
At the end of the 8-week course, the group will produce 3 original comedy sketches that will be screened for friends and family. Students will also walk away with a writing credit for the sketch that they wrote and directed. The class size is limited to 12 people in order to give a tailored, hands-on approach.

The class will be taught by Eric Christensen, Joshua McNew and Lauren Vemuri. Classes will be held on Sundays from 7 p.m. - 9 p.m. at Nebula Coworking (3407 S Jefferson Ave, St. Louis, MO 63118).

STL Up Late is a late night talk show that combines elements of late night talk shows like Conan and The Tonight Show with sketch shows like SNL The show has now been running for three seasons and has produced hundreds of comedic sketches. STL Up Late has been recognized by the Riverfront Times as one of the "Best Comedy Shows in St. Louis" and was placed on the "A-List" by St. Louis Magazine. Eric is the creator and director of STL Up Late. Before moving to St. Louis, Eric started his career in Chicago where he studied and performed at the famous iO Theatre and created a pilot for Dennis Leary's production company, Apostle Films, with his independent comedy group, Michael Pizza. Currently Eric works as a writer and performer for the popular YouTube channel Vat19 while trying to find time to ride his bike across Missouri.

Joshua is the executive producer of STL Up Late. He has produced award-winning films, studio albums, and viral digital content. He holds a degree in Media Studies and is currently pursuing a Master of Fine Arts in Digital Arts. As the co-creator of STL Up Late, Joshua is committed to using his entrepreneurial spirit and artistic vision to give St. Louis a fun and engaging place to tell their story.
